Kandi Burruss Shares Peaceful Thanksgiving After Divorce Announcement

In a social media post, Burruss shared a family photo, noting Todd was absent from the picture. She clarified in the comments that Todd had attended the Thanksgiving meal but was not in the photo, writing, "He was not left out or anything like that."


Burruss captioned her post, "Happy Thanksgiving. I truly enjoyed my day with my fam. I hope you enjoyed yours! Now I feel stuffed like a turkey & need to lay down."


The singer and television personality announced her decision to file for divorce after 15 years of marriage last Friday. She stated that her focus would be on "protecting my peace, being the best mother I can be, and co-parenting with love and respect."


According to TMZ, the couple reportedly split a few months ago and maintained an amicable relationship. Kandi Burruss and Todd Tucker have two children: a 9-year-old son and a 6-year-old daughter.
